BridgeValley Community & Technical College offers 98 major programs for degree granting/certificate programs. Of that, the distance learning opportunity (online degrees/courses) is given to 1 major programs - 1 Associate.
The 2025 tuition & fees is $5,800 for West Virginia residents and $12,428 for out-of-state students.
Total 461 students out of total 1,927 students have enrolled online exclusively. Last year, total 21 students have completed their degree/certificate program through distance learning.
BridgeValley Community & Technical College is accredited by Higher Learning Commission.

2025 Tuition & Fees
The following table and chart describe 2024-2025 tuition & fees and costs trends over last 5 years at BridgeValley Community & Technical College. Each cost is an average amount over the all offered programs. For West Virginia residents, the tuition & fees are $5,800 and $12,428 for non-West Virginia residents.
The cost per credit hour for part-time students or overload credits of full-time students is $200 for West Virginia residents and $476 for out-of-state students for undergraduate programs.

Distance Learning Program Student Population
At BridgeValley Community & Technical College, there are 1,927 students including in both undergraduate and graduate schools, with full-time and part-time status. Of that, 1,445 students were attending classes through distance learning (461 students are enrolled exclusively and 984 are enrolled in some online courses).
Distance Learning Enrollment Distribution
| Total Enrollment | 1,927 | |
| Enrolled Exclusively in Online Courses | 461 |
| Enrolled in Some But Not All Online Courses | 984 |
| Not Enrolled In Any Online Courses | 482 |
By location where enrolled students live, out of a total of 461 enrolled exclusively in online courses, 454 West Virginia Residents were enrolled in online classes exclusively, 7 students living in the U.S. States other than West Virginia, and 0 non-U.S. students enrolled in online courses.
